Welcome back to the Sutta Meditation Series Podcast. In this segment, we look at the question of "HOW CAN YOU MEASURE SOMEONE'S METTA PRACTICE?" by: highlighting the perfection of metta by the Buddha and the Noble Arahants mentioning Queen Samavati who declared by the Buddha as the foremost lay female disciple in dwelling in loving kindness recognising higher virtue (adhisīla), higher thought (adhicitta) and higher wisdom (adhipaññā) in one's/someone's practice seeing the internal and external practice of loving kindness coming together looking at how we can honour and meditate on the Buddha and the Noble Arahants in our practise of loving kindness Bohoma pin to the person/people who have asked this Dhamma question.
